Josh Groban and Jennifer Hudson Announce North American Arena Tour

Two of the most powerful voices in entertainment are joining forces for an unforgettable summer. Josh Groban—five-time Grammy nominee, Tony nominee, and multi-platinum recording artist—has announced a 16-date North American arena tour with special guest Jennifer Hudson, the EGOT-winning singer, actress, and talk show host. The tour, produced by Live Nation and presented by Stifel, launches June 2, 2026, in Montreal and wraps July 3 in Salt Lake City.

"Performing live has always been one of the greatest joys of my life, and getting to share these nights with Jennifer, someone I admire so deeply, makes it all the more special," Groban said. "These shows are going to be emotional, celebratory, and full of surprises. I can't wait to see everyone this summer." The announcement was made on The Jennifer Hudson Show, where Hudson expressed equal enthusiasm: "To be able to tour with you is a dream. This can't be my life. But I am so excited!"

Plus: Josh Groban's GEMS World Tour 2026

The North American dates follow Groban's highly anticipated GEMS World Tour—his first global tour in ten years. Launching February 7, 2026, in Honolulu, the international leg spans 21 cities across Asia, Australia, the Middle East, and Europe before the Jennifer Hudson collaboration begins in June. The tour celebrates his recent albums Gems and Hidden Gems, offering fans a career-spanning journey through 25 years of music. Visit joshgroban.com for official updates.

Jennifer Hudson: From American Idol to EGOT Legend

Jennifer Hudson is one of only 21 people in history to achieve EGOT status—winning an Emmy, Grammy, Oscar, and Tony Award. Born September 12, 1981, in Chicago, she rose to fame as a finalist on American Idol Season 3 in 2004, finishing seventh but capturing hearts with her stunning vocal performances.

Her breakthrough came in 2006 when she beat out 780 competitors—including American Idol winner Fantasia Barrino—to land the role of Effie White in the film adaptation of Dreamgirls. Her showstopping rendition of "And I Am Telling You I'm Not Going" became an instant classic, earning her the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ress, a Golden Globe, a BAFTA, and a Screen Actors Guild Award. She was just 25 years old.

Hudson won her first Grammy Award in 2009 for Best R&B Album for her self-titled debut, and a second in 2017 for Best Musical Theater Album for The Color Purple revival. In 2021, she won a Daytime Emmy as a producer of the animated short Baba Yaga. Her Tony Award came in 2022 as a producer of A Strange Loop, which won Best Musical—making her the youngest woman and third Black person to complete the EGOT. She currently hosts The Jennifer Hudson Show and released her fourth studio album, The Gift of Love, in October 2024.

Josh Groban: 25 Years of Vocal Excellence

Josh Groban has been enchanting audiences since his self-titled debut in 2001, when his powerful lyric baritone introduced a new generation to classical crossover music. Born February 27, 1981, in Los Angeles, his path to stardom began when he stood in for Andrea Bocelli during 1998 Grammy rehearsals—impressing legendary producer David Foster while still in high school.

His discography includes chart-topping albums like the six-times-platinum Closer, the seven-times-platinum holiday classic Noël (the best-selling album by a male solo artist in 2007), and subsequent releases including Awake, Illuminations, All That Echoes, Stages, Bridges, and Harmony. With over 35 million albums sold worldwide, Groban remains one of the most successful artists in contemporary music.

Beyond recording, Groban has proven himself a Broadway star, earning a Tony nomination for his 2016 debut in Natasha, Pierre & The Great Comet of 1812 and widespread acclaim for his 2023 portrayal of the title role in Sweeney Todd. In May 2025, he delivered a sold-out five-night residency at The Colosseum at Caesars Palace in Las Vegas, and in September performed back-to-back sold-out shows at the Hollywood Bowl with the LA Philharmonic.

GEMS and Hidden Gems: A Career-Spanning Celebration

The 2026 tours showcase material from Groban's recent releases. Gems is an 18-track collection featuring his greatest recordings, including the three-times-platinum signature anthem "You Raise Me Up," Billboard Adult Contemporary #1 "To Where You Are," his haunting rendition of "Evermore" from Disney's Beauty and the Beast, and beloved covers like "Over the Rainbow," "Pure Imagination," and "Bridge Over Troubled Water."

Hidden Gems, released November 14, 2025, brings together 11 rare tracks, many previously unavailable on streaming. Highlights include the brand-new song "The Constant," co-written with EGOT-winning duo Benj Pasek and Justin Paul (The Greatest Showman, La La Land, Dear Evan Hansen), plus fan-favorite deep cuts like "Signs" and "Everything You Needed," a ballad gifted to Groban by pop icon Sia.

The Find Your Light Foundation

One dollar from every ticket sold on the North American tour benefits Groban's Find Your Light Foundation, which enriches young people's lives through arts education, cultural awareness, and creative programming. The foundation's October 2025 Benefit Concert raised $1.5 million for arts education, featuring performances alongside Ben Folds, Norah Jones, and opera star Renée Fleming. What is an EGOT and does Jennifer Hudson have one?

EGOT stands for Emmy, Grammy, Oscar, and Tony—the four major American entertainment awards. Jennifer Hudson achieved EGOT status in 2022 when A Strange Loop, which she co-produced, won the Tony Award for Best Musical. She is the youngest woman and third Black person in history to complete the EGOT, joining an elite group of only 21 individuals.

What songs is Jennifer Hudson famous for?

Jennifer Hudson is best known for her showstopping performance of "And I Am Telling You I'm Not Going" from Dreamgirls, which won her an Academy Award. Her hit songs include "Spotlight," "If This Isn't Love," "Where You At," and "I Remember Me." She also starred as Aretha Franklin in the 2021 biopic Respect, performing classics like "Respect" and "Think."

What awards has Josh Groban won?

Josh Groban has received five Grammy nominations, a Tony nomination for Natasha, Pierre & The Great Comet of 1812, and an Emmy nomination. While he hasn't won these major awards, his commercial success includes 35 million albums sold worldwide, multiple platinum certifications, and two American Music Awards. His Broadway work in Sweeney Todd earned widespread acclaim.
